gpt4 book ai didi

java - 添加到 HashMap 给出 NPI

转载 作者:行者123 更新时间:2023-12-01 08:16:16 25 4
gpt4 key购买 nike

在我的启动时运行的主类中,它尝试将一些数据放入 HashMap 中。但它说 HashMap 为 null,并且无法添加数据。

public class COD extends JavaPlugin{

public void loadConfig(){
Settings.gunradius.put("Famas", getConfig().getInt("guns.Famas"));
}
}

public class Settings {
static HashMap<String, Integer> gunradius;
}

它不会将数据放入HashMap中。我怀疑这与静态方法有关,但我真的不知道。

最佳答案

使用前需要初始化HashMap。内化到对象的默认值是 null

static final Map<String, Integer> gunradius = new HashMap<String, Integer>();

关于java - 添加到 HashMap 给出 NPI,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13200427/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com